Mushroom Omelette

Soft omelette filled with richly fried mushrooms, onions and parsley.

Instructions

  1. Clean the mushrooms with a cloth, trim the stem ends and cut the mushrooms into slices about 4 mm thick; finely dice the onion.
  2. Heat the oil in a pan until hot and fry the mushrooms for 5–6 min. without salting too early, until the liquid has evaporated and the slices brown.
  3. Add the onion, cook for 2 min., season with salt and pepper, stir in the chopped parsley and set the filling aside.
  4. Whisk the eggs vigorously with the milk, salt and pepper for 1 min. until the mixture is evenly pale yellow.
  5. Melt half the butter in a 24 cm nonstick pan, pour in half the egg mixture and let it set over low heat for 3–4 min., pulling the set edges toward the center with a spatula.
  6. Once the surface only glistens lightly, spoon half the mushrooms onto one side, fold the omelette over, slide it onto a plate, prepare the second omelette the same way and serve immediately.
